Dataframe to list of tuples in python

WebJul 1, 2024 · I originally converted my dataframe to a list of tuples for faster row processing: df.to_records (index=False).tolist () Unfortunately in the conversion the values in df.start_time were converted from a to a . The solution: WebFind all indexes Strings in a Python List which contains the Text. In the previous example, we looked for the first occurrence of text in the list. If we want to locate all the instances or occurrences of text in the string, then we need to use the index () method multiple times in a loop. During each iteration, pass the start index as the ...

How to Convert Tuple to DataFrame in Python - AppDividend

WebDec 21, 2024 · After filtering according to the tup_list, the new dataframe should be: A B 118 35 35 35. Only exact pairings should be returned. Currently Im using df= df.merge (tup_list, on= ['A','B'], how='inner'). But is not very efficient as my actual data is larger. Please advise on more efficient way of writing. python. Webmelt () is an alias for unpivot (). New in version 3.4.0. Parameters. idsstr, Column, tuple, list, optional. Column (s) to use as identifiers. Can be a single column or column name, or a … north face mens winter jacket https://onsitespecialengineering.com

Find Length of List in Python - thisPointer

Webpandas.DataFrame.itertuples# DataFrame. itertuples (index = True, name ... The column names will be renamed to positional names if they are invalid Python identifiers, repeated, or start with an underscore. ... By setting the index parameter to False we can remove the index as the first element of the tuple: >>> for row in df. itertuples (index ... WebJul 18, 2024 · Method 1: Using collect () method. By converting each row into a tuple and by appending the rows to a list, we can get the data in the list of tuple format. tuple (): It is … WebTo find the length of a List in Python, we can use the len () method of Python. It internally calls the __len__ () method of the object which we pass into it. Also, the List has an overloaded implementation of __len__ () method, which returns the count of number of elements in the list. So basically len () method will return the number of ... how to save money as a teenager

Python - Create a List of Tuples - GeeksforGeeks

Category:dataframe - Convert df column to a tuple - Stack Overflow

Tags:Dataframe to list of tuples in python

Dataframe to list of tuples in python

Find a String inside a List in Python - thisPointer

WebOct 13, 2024 ·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ams WebJul 20, 2016 · One possibility is to swap the order of the index elements and the values from iteritems:. res = [(val, idx) for idx, val in s.iteritems()] EDIT: @Divakar's answer is faster by about a factor of 2.

Dataframe to list of tuples in python

Did you know?

WebWe can do that using Dictionary Comprehension. First, zip the lists of keys values using the zip () method, to get a sequence of tuples. Then iterate over this sequence of tuples … WebHaving said that, beware that storing tuples in DataFrames dooms you to Python-speed loops. To take advantage of fast Pandas/NumPy routines, you need to use native NumPy dtypes such as np.float64 (whereas, in contrast, tuples require "object" dtype).. So perhaps a better solution for your purpose is to use two separate DataFrames, one for the strings …

WebIf you want to convert a flat list into a dataframe row, then convert it into a nested list first: df = pd.DataFrame ( [my_list]) If you want to convert a nested list into a DataFrame where each sub-list is a DataFrame column, convert it into a dictionary and cast into a DataFrame. Make sure that the number of column names match the length of ... WebThe index() method of List accepts the element that need to be searched and also the starting index position from where it need to look into the list. So we can use a while loop to call the index() method multiple times. But each time we will pass the index position which is next to the last covered index position. Like in the first iteration, we will try to find the …

WebAug 19, 2024 · You can use the following basic syntax to create a tuple from two columns in a pandas DataFrame: df ['new_column'] = list (zip (df.column1, df.column2)) This particular formula creates a new column called new_column, which is a tuple formed by column1 and column2 in the DataFrame. The following example shows how to use this syntax in … WebJun 1, 2024 · However, in each list(row) of rdd, we can see that not all column names are there. For example, in the first row, only 'n', 's' appeared, while there is no 's' in the second row. So I want to convert this rdd to a dataframe, where the values should be 0 for columns that do not show up in the original tuple.

WebWe can do that using Dictionary Comprehension. First, zip the lists of keys values using the zip () method, to get a sequence of tuples. Then iterate over this sequence of tuples using a for loop inside a dictionary comprehension and for each tuple initialised a key value pair in the dictionary. All these can be done in a single line using the ...

WebMar 5, 2024 · To convert a DataFrame to a list of tuples in Pandas: list(df.itertuples(index=False)) [Pandas (A=3, B=5), Pandas (A=4, B=6)] filter_none. Note … north face men\\u0027s apex insulated etip glovesWebJan 18, 2015 · If you convert a dataframe to a list of lists you will lose information - namely the index and columns names. My solution: use to_dict () dict_of_lists = df.to_dict (orient='split') This will give you a dictionary with three lists: index, columns, data. If you decide you really don't need the columns and index names, you get the data with. how to save money as a parentWebOct 3, 2024 · Add a comment. 1. The line below gives the desired list of tuples assuming that df is your pandas dataframe: list_tuples = list (df [ ['Date', 'Close']].to_records (index=True)) Edit: Edited answer so that the result is exactly the tuples you want. Share. Improve this answer. Follow. edited Oct 8, 2024 at 21:59. how to save money at disneyWebSep 30, 2024 · Let us see how to convert a DataFrame to a list of dictionaries by using the df.to_dict () method. In Python DataFrame.to_dict () method is used to covert a dataframe into a list of dictionaries. Let’s … north face men\u0027s back-to-berkeley iiiWebSep 28, 2024 · In order to convert a Pandas DataFrame into a list of tuples, you can use the .to_records () method and chain it with the .tolist () method. The .to_records () method converts the DataFrames records into tuple-like containers. When the .tolist () method is then applied, the object is converted to a Python list. north face men\u0027s apex insulated etip glovesWebExample. You can create a DataFrame from a list of simple tuples, and can even choose the specific elements of the tuples you want to use. Here we will create a DataFrame … north face men\\u0027s atlas triclimate jacketWebJul 18, 2024 · Method 1: Using collect () method. By converting each row into a tuple and by appending the rows to a list, we can get the data in the list of tuple format. tuple (): It is used to convert data into tuple format. Syntax: tuple (rows) Example: Converting dataframe into a list of tuples. Python3. north face men\u0027s beanies